Dr Israel Bactol, a promising 34-year-old Cardiology Fellow working at the Philippine Heart Center (PHC), lost his fight against Covid-19, on March 21.
âIâve been around many physicians. Everybodyâs brilliant. But, every now and then, you come across a person who just separates himself from the crowd. Thatâs El,â Dr Tom-Louie Acosta told Rappler in an interview.
Acosta, an internist, is Bactolâs close friend and co-trainee from his 3-year residency at Premiere Medical Center in Cabanatuan City.
âYou canât help but gravitate towards him because he was such a beautiful person, on top of being a brilliant physician,â he added.
Bactolâs memory is etched in the hearts of his family, friends, fellow physcians, hospital colleagues, and patients coming from underserved communities.
